France's Golden Elixir: The Art of Crafting Champagne
Champagne, the quintessential sparkling wine of France, is more than just a beverage; it's a testament to centuries of tradition and skillful craftsmanship. In the heart of Champagne, skilled artisans meticulously nurture Chardonnay, Pinot Noir, and Pinot Meunier grapes on mineral-rich soils. These grapes are then transformed into a liquid that embodies the very essence of celebration.
The complex process of Champagne production begins with picking the ripe grapes and transmuting them into calm wine. This base wine then undergoes a second change, trapped within the bottle, giving birth to the characteristic effervescence that defines Champagne.
Each bottle is meticulously aged for at least fifteen months, allowing the flavors to mature. The result is a sparkling nectar that captivates the palate with its complexity and elegance.

Champagne Production: From Grapevine to Glass in the Heart of France
In the heart of France, amidst rolling hills and verdant vineyards, lies the birthplace of Champagne. The production of this effervescent beverage is a meticulous process, steeped in tradition and demanding unwavering precision. From the selection of lush soil to the careful cultivation of clusters, each stage affects the final taste and quality of the Champagne.
Harvesting happens during the autumn months, when the grapes reach peak ripeness. The extraction process releases the sweet juice, which is then fermented into wine.
